Transaction 40fec40ff85cc3568e80845e74b3f0b2a4348635dc4d004675723c1d717d7ff0

1 Input
2 Outputs
  • 40fec40ff85cc3568e80845e74b3f0b2a4348635dc4d004675723c1d717d7ff0:0
  • value  1724621
    address  2MwZUD7Kkfvcw2p38EwEzoSuQcfsyg2hLYa
  • 40fec40ff85cc3568e80845e74b3f0b2a4348635dc4d004675723c1d717d7ff0:1
  • value  2939785068
    address  2N12EuMcvh1qVSz77tjnAZaqnqHDMDvdaRG